Quantum Image Watermarking Algorithm Based on Haar Wavelet Transform

open access: yesIEEE Access, 2019
In this paper, a novel frequency domain quantum watermarking scheme is proposed based on the Flexible Representation of Quantum Images, which can embed a $2^{n1}\times 2^{n1}$ binary watermark image into a $2^{n}\times 2^{n}$ grayscale carrier image.

HAAR WAVELET ANALYSIS OF CLIMATIC TIME SERIES

open access: yesInternational Journal of Wavelets, Multiresolution and Information Processing, 2014
In order to extract the intrinsic information of climatic time series from background red noise, in this paper, we will first give an analytic formula on the distribution of Haar wavelet power spectra of red noise in a rigorous statistical framework. After that, by comparing the difference of wavelet power spectra of real climatic time series and red ...
